- // S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-only
- /*
- * Copyright (C) 2015-2020 ARM Limited.
- * Original author: Dave Martin <[email protected]>
- */
- #include <assert.h>
- #include <errno.h>
- #include <stdio.h>
- #include <stdlib.h>
- #include <string.h>
- #include <sys/auxv.h>
- #include <sys/prctl.h>
- #include <asm/sigcontext.h>
- #include "../../kselftest.h"
- #include "rdvl.h"
- int main(int argc, char **argv)
- {
- unsigned int vq;
- int vl;
- static unsigned int vqs[SVE_VQ_MAX];
- unsigned int nvqs = 0;
- ksft_print_header();
- ksft_set_plan(2);
- if (!(getauxval(AT_HWCAP) & HWCAP_SVE))
- ksft_exit_skip("SVE not available\n");
- /*
- * Enumerate up to SVE_VQ_MAX vector lengths
- */
- for (vq = SVE_VQ_MAX; vq > 0; --vq) {
- vl = prctl(PR_SVE_SET_VL, vq * 16);
- if (vl == -1)
- ksft_exit_fail_msg("PR_SVE_SET_VL failed: %s (%d)\n",
- strerror(errno), errno);
- vl &= PR_SVE_VL_LEN_MASK;
- if (rdvl_sve() != vl)
- ksft_exit_fail_msg("PR_SVE_SET_VL reports %d, RDVL %d\n",
- vl, rdvl_sve());
- if (!sve_vl_valid(vl))
- ksft_exit_fail_msg("VL %d invalid\n", vl);
- vq = sve_vq_from_vl(vl);
- if (!(nvqs < SVE_VQ_MAX))
- ksft_exit_fail_msg("Too many VLs %u >= SVE_VQ_MAX\n",
- nvqs);
- vqs[nvqs++] = vq;
- }
- ksft_test_result_pass("Enumerated %d vector lengths\n", nvqs);
- ksft_test_result_pass("All vector lengths valid\n");
- /* Print out the vector lengths in ascending order: */
- while (nvqs--)
- ksft_print_msg("%u\n", 16 * vqs[nvqs]);
- ksft_exit_pass();
- }
